Kennett is a perfect 10-0 against Malden since May of 2019 and they'll have a chance to extend that dominance on Tuesday. Kennett will be playing at home against Malden at 3:00 p.m. One thing working in Kennett's favor is that they have posted at least ten runs in their last five matchups.
On Monday, Kennett got the win against Holcomb by a conclusive 16-1. The Indians might be getting used to big wins seeing as the team has won five games by ten runs or more this season.
Handley McAtee was a standout: she went a perfect 2-for-2 with four RBI, two runs, and one stolen base. That's the most RBI she has posted since back in April of 2024. The team also got some help courtesy of Kynsly McCaig, who went 2-for-3 with one triple, two RBI, and one run.
McAtee wasn't the only one working in the hit department: Kennett kept the outfield on their toes and finished the game with 12 hits.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now got at least nine hits every time they've taken the field this season.
Meanwhile, Malden faced Bernie in a battle between two of the state's top teams on Monday. Malden walked away with a 7-4 win over Bernie. Give some credit to the fans of both teams: the last five times they've met, the home team has come away the winner.
Alyssa Broom sp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: she surrendered only one earned (and three unearned) runs on four hits.
On the hitting side, the team relied heavily on Mariah Loya, who went a perfect 4-for-4 with one triple, two RBI, and one run. Camryn Ellison was another key player, scoring two runs and stealing a base while going 2-for-2.
Kennett pushed their record up to 6-1 with the victory, which was their third straight at home. Those wins came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 0.7 runs on average over those games. As for Malden, their victory bumped their record up to 6-2.
Tuesday's contest will be a test for both teams' pitchers. Kennett hasn't had any issues making contact this season, having earned a batting average of .460. However, it's not like Malden struggles in that department as they've averaged .441. With both teams so capable at the plate, fans should be ready for an impressive hitting performance.
Everything went Kennett's way against Malden in their previous matchup back in May of 2024, as Kennett made off with a 16-0 win. Will Kennett repeat their success, or does Malden has a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
